Prep Cook Salary in Lansing, MI
Based on available job listings, the average salary for Prep Cooks in Lansing is $35,000 per year or $16.83 per hour annually. Keep in mind that pay can vary depending on the employer and experience level.
Salaries typically range between $25,000 per year and $55,000 per year, reflecting differing kitchen sizes, cuisines, and role responsibilities.
Lowest wage for Prep Cooks in Lansing | Average wage for Prep Cooks in Lansing | Highest wage for Prep Cooks in Lansing |
---|---|---|
$25,000 per year | $35,000 per year or $16.83 per hour | $55,000 per year |
Larger hotels and busy restaurants often offer higher wages compared to smaller or casual dining venues.

What To Expect as a Prep Cook in Lansing
Prep Cook roles usually involve:
- Preparing ingredients and mise en place
- Assisting chefs with meal prep
- Maintaining cleanliness and organisation of the kitchen
- Following food safety protocols
Employers expect Prep Cooks to work efficiently and communicate well under pressure.
Most full-time positions require availability during peak meal service times and weekends.
Training is often provided, making this a great entry-level opportunity for those passionate about culinary arts.
